Cognitive Biases that Influence Gambling Behavior

Cognitive biases play a significant role in shaping gambling actions and decisions, often leading players to misinterpret odds and outcomes. One of the most prevalent biases is the illusion of control, where individuals believe they can influence the results of games primarily based on chance. This false sense of agency can result in persistently risky choices, disregarding the house edge that favors the establishment.

Strategies for Managing Emotion in Casino Environments

Emotional responses play a significant role in decision-making within wagering venues. Implementing effective techniques to handle emotions can enhance the overall experience and support responsible gambling practices.

  • Set Limits: Establishing financial and time boundaries before entering a wagering establishment helps maintain control. Adhering to these limits minimizes emotional highs and lows associated with wins and losses.
  • Practice Mindfulness: Being aware of one’s feelings and thoughts can assist in moderating impulsive actions. Techniques such as deep breathing or brief meditations can ground players during intense moments.
  • Develop a Budget: Allocating a specific amount for entertainment ensures that spending remains within personal means. This strategy aids in reducing anxiety linked to financial risk versus reward.
  • Take Breaks: Stepping away from the action allows for reflection and emotional recalibration. Regular intervals can prevent escalation of negative feelings and encourage rational decision-making.
  • Focus on Enjoyment: Shifting attention from winning to the overall experience can reduce the pressure to succeed. Emphasizing fun over financial gain fosters positive behavior and a healthier mindset.

These approaches can guide individuals in navigating their emotions more effectively while engaging in recreational activities. By cultivating resilience against the innate house edge and its impact on emotional states, players can develop healthier gambling behavior.
